Abstract

The present invention discloses a bidirectional control system and method of intelligent household electrical appliances. The system can utilize a plurality of remote user terminals to control various intelligent household electrical appliances needing to be operated. A user operates the devices, such as a mobile phone, a tablet computer, a computer, etc., to input a control instruction, the control instruction reaches a remote controller (a remote control module) via a network, and the remote controller forwards the data to the intelligent household electrical appliances to execute, at the same time, the execution states returned by the intelligent household electrical appliances are obtained in different manners. The remote controller comprises a transferring sending module, a transferring receiving module and a main control module, and the main control module analyzes the communication data between the remote user terminals and the intelligent household electrical appliances, and forwards to the corresponding remote user terminals or the intelligent household electrical appliances via the transferring sending module. According to the present invention, the intelligent household electrical appliances can be controlled completely, the current states of all intelligent household electrical appliances can be grasped and controlled timely and at any time, thereby improving the controllability, accuracy and convenience of an intelligent home.

Background technology
Remote control is one and has developed the technology of more than ten years, and everybody passes through various telepilot every day and controls TV, air-conditioning, automobile etc.Usually the telepilot that we use extensively adopts low-power consumption, the low cost communication modes such as infrared, 315M, 433M to realize face-to-face remote control.This face-to-face remote control is all one-way communication, and namely telepilot sends instruction, and equipment receives instruction and performs.
Such as, but along with the development of the universal of smart mobile phone and Internet of Things, people wish the real time remote network control realizing equipment such as household electrical appliance by mobile phone, computer etc., and Long-distance Control Curtain switch, regulates air-conditioner temperature, long-rangely give fish jar oxygenation etc.Prior art has had corresponding implementation, but equipment outwards can not send signal.Therefore, during Remote, we cannot confirm whether telecommand runs succeeded, such as the switch of our Remote Open air-conditioning, but cannot learn whether air-conditioning is correctly started.

Embodiment
Below in conjunction with drawings and Examples, describe the course of work of the present invention in detail.
As shown in Figure 1, the direction Control System of the intelligent appliance that one embodiment of the invention proposes, comprising three kinds of equipment, is remote user end, remote controllers and intelligent appliance respectively.Remote user end can be the communication apparatus that computer, smart mobile phone or panel computer etc. can be networked, intelligent appliance then comprises various daily household electrical appliance, such as air-conditioning, water heater, refrigerator, soy bean milk making machine, electric cooker etc., the quantity of remote user end and intelligent appliance is not limit, and can carry out communication by multi-to-multi.Further, adopt the less radio-frequency of 2.4G, RF(315M, 433M between remote controllers and intelligent appliance), one in infrared ray, mobile cellular network or its be combined into the news that work.
Remote user end is for mobile phone, intelligent appliance for air-conditioning below, opens and is described embodiments of the invention.
Mobile phone can install corresponding application program, select the air-conditioning needing operation in the application, then corresponding steering order is inputted, by the communication network of mobile phone, the steering order of correspondence is sent router and be transmitted to remote controllers again, these steering orders comprise by unique ID corresponding to the air-conditioning that operates, and a certain steering order of this air-conditioning, such as power-on command etc.
After remote controllers receive the steering order of mobile phone transmission, these steering orders resolved, steering order is transmitted to air-conditioning and performs, this end of air-conditioning has wireless receiving module and wireless sending module, wireless receiving module receives the steering order that remote controllers forward, and performs after parsing again.Started shooting by the air-conditioning state of success or not of wireless sending module is transmitted to the mobile phone sending steering order by remote controllers.
In addition, it is executing state querying command that mobile phone can also send a kind of steering order, user can send executing state querying command by mobile phone, allows air-conditioning return current state instruction to mobile phone, thus makes it far-end effector and check understanding equipment current state at any time.
Air-conditioning also comprises a memory module for storing the steering order of current execution, when air-conditioning receives the executing state querying command of mobile phone transmission, steering order data in its memory module are sent to mobile phone by air-conditioning, the steering order data that the steering order data received and last time send contrast by mobile phone, if identical, then air-conditioning performs instruction success.If mobile phone have issued executing state querying command, do not receive any feedback, or the steering order received and its storage is inconsistent, then judge that air-conditioning performs failure, can retransmit a steering order.
As shown in Figure 2 and Figure 3, the bidirection control method of the Smart Home that the invention allows for, equally for mobile phone and air-conditioning, comprises the steps:
Step 1: user selects by application program on mobile phone the air-conditioning needing operation, and inputs corresponding steering order, the unique ID of air-conditioning and steering order is packaged into steering order and sends to remote controllers;
Step 2: then remote controllers receive the steering order of mobile phone, after carrying out Treatment Analysis, is transmitted to corresponding air-conditioning to steering order;
Step 3: air-conditioning performs after receiving steering order, returns its executing state simultaneously;
Step 4: described remote controllers are resolved after receiving the executing state that air-conditioning returns, and send to corresponding mobile phone, if mobile phone does not receive the executing state that air-conditioning returns, then judge that air-conditioning performs failure, will steering order be retransmitted.
Step 5: mobile phone sends executing state querying command, remote controllers receive the steering order of mobile phone, after Treatment Analysis is carried out to steering order, be transmitted to corresponding air-conditioning, after air-conditioning receives steering order, the steering order of the last time of being preserved, mobile phone is transmitted to by remote controllers, whether the steering order that mobile phone contrasts steering order and the last time of its preservation returned is identical, if identical, then judges to run succeeded.If not identical or do not receive the steering order returned, then show may there is Communication Jamming or fault between mobile phone and remote controllers, initiate by mobile phone the correct execution that mechanism for correcting errors (such as resending order) guarantees instruction.
